How does the Tor network enhance online security?

The Tor network plays a unique role in online privacy by making it harder to link your browsing activity to your real identity or location. It does this through a system called onion routing, which sends your traffic through multiple volunteer operated servers rather than directly from you to a website.

Anonymous browsing tools beyond Tor

Tor is one of several anonymous browsing tools that aim to reduce tracking and surveillance. Unlike a standard web browser, the Tor Browser is configured to route traffic through the Tor network by default. It disables many tracking features, isolates website activity into separate circuits, and standardizes the browser fingerprint so users look more similar to one another.

Other anonymous browsing tools include privacy focused browsers and regular virtual private networks, but they work differently. A basic VPN sends your traffic through a single provider, which can still see your real IP address. Tor, by contrast, uses at least three relays and tries to ensure that no single relay knows both who you are and what you are doing.

How to use onion routing step by step

To learn how to use onion routing, you typically start by installing the Tor Browser from the official Tor Project website. Once installed, you open it like any other browser. When you connect, the browser automatically builds a Tor circuit through three relays: an entry node, a middle relay, and an exit node. Your traffic is layered with encryption so that each relay only knows where to send the next layer.

From the user perspective, browsing with Tor looks similar to using a normal browser, but it may feel slower. This is because your traffic is bouncing through multiple relays around the world. As a beginner, it is important not to add extra browser extensions, change advanced settings without understanding them, or log in to accounts that reveal your identity, as these can reduce the anonymity benefits.

VPN configuration for onion network traffic

Some people combine a VPN with Tor for additional privacy layers, often described in terms like VPN over Tor or Tor over VPN. VPN configuration for onion network use depends on which order you choose. With Tor over VPN, you first connect to a VPN and then open the Tor Browser. Your internet service provider sees only encrypted VPN traffic, while the VPN sees that you are connecting to the Tor network.

With VPN over Tor, which usually requires more advanced setup, your traffic first enters the Tor network and then exits through a VPN server. This can hide Tor use from websites, but it is harder to configure correctly and not all VPN services support it. In either case, you must remember that adding a VPN introduces a commercial provider that you need to trust, and misconfiguration can weaken instead of strengthen your privacy.

Secure internet privacy solutions with Tor

Tor is one piece in a broader toolkit of secure internet privacy solutions. It mainly protects the link between your device and the websites you access by obscuring where your traffic comes from. However, Tor does not automatically encrypt what you do at the destination site unless that site itself uses secure connections, such as HTTPS.

For many people, combining Tor with good digital habits offers more meaningful protection. This may include using strong, unique passwords, enabling two factor authentication on important accounts, keeping software updated, and separating online identities for different activities. Tor can help prevent some types of network surveillance, but it cannot fix weak passwords, phishing, or unsafe downloads.

Practical Tor network security tips

Applying Tor network security tips can significantly reduce common risks. First, always download Tor Browser only from the official project site and verify that you have the most recent version. Second, avoid maximizing the browser window, installing extra plugins, or changing core privacy settings, because these actions can make you stand out from other users.

Another important practice is to be cautious about logging in to accounts that contain your real name, address, or other personal details while using Tor, since this can link your Tor activity to your offline identity. Be careful when downloading files; opening some types of documents outside Tor Browser can reveal your real IP address. Finally, remember that Tor does not make illegal behavior safe or consequences free. It is designed to improve privacy and resist censorship, but staying within the law and respecting the rights of others remains essential.
